  • Title

    Tuning characteristics of Gunn diode in conical-section waveguide mounts

  • Abstract
    The Bialkowski approach as extended by Bates is applied to solve for the driving-point impedance for a conical cap waveguide mount of arbitrary angle of taper. As an application of the driving-point impedance model, a Gunn diode oscillator was designed and its tuning characteristics using two such waveguide mounts were measured. The predicted and experimental results agree closely.
